Cable connections should be kept dry and off the ground.

Mains power connection

The following should be ob- served when connecting the high pressure washer to the electric installation:

Only connect the machine to an installation with earth con- nection.

The electric installation shall be made by a certifi ed elec- trician.

It is strongly recommended that the electric supply to this machine should include a re- sidual current device (GFCI).

Water connection Connection to the public mains according to regulations.

IMPORTANT! Only use wa- ter without any impurities. If there is a risk of running sands in the inlet water (i.e. from your own well), an additional fi lter should be mounted.

Repair and maintenance WARNING! Always remove the electric plug from the socket be- fore carrying out maintenance work on the machine.

Safety devices

Locking device on spray gun (7a) (see foldout at the end of this manual):

The spray gun features a lock- ing device. When the pawl is activated, the spray gun cannot be operated.

Thermal sensor:

A thermal sensor protects the motor against overloading. The machine will restart after a few minutes when the thermal sen- sor has cooled.

Nilfisk-ALTO is a renowned brand in the realm of cleaning equipment, offering a variety of high-performance pressure washers that cater to both DIY enthusiasts and professional users. Among their standout models are the Nilfisk-ALTO E 130.1 and E 140.1, which exemplify efficiency, versatility, and user-friendly design.

The Nilfisk-ALTO E 130.1 is engineered for domestic cleaning tasks, making it ideal for users who seek a powerful yet compact pressure washer. With a maximum pressure of 130 bar and a water flow rate of 440 liters per hour, this model delivers ample cleaning power for various surfaces, from patios and driveways to garden furniture and vehicles. The E 130.1 features an innovative click-and-clean nozzle system, allowing users to easily switch between pressure and wide-angle spray patterns, enhancing its functionality for different applications.

In contrast, the Nilfisk-ALTO E 140.1 offers a higher performance level, with a maximum pressure of 140 bar and a flow rate of 500 liters per hour. This model is ideal for more demanding cleaning tasks, providing the capacity to tackle tougher grime and larger areas more efficiently. The E 140.1 also boasts the click-and-clean system, which makes it easy to customize the cleaning experience based on the task at hand.

Both models are equipped with an integrated detergent tank, allowing for easy application of cleaning solutions to enhance efficiency. They are designed with ergonomics in mind, featuring comfortable handles and lightweight constructions that make them easy to maneuver. The robust wheels further improve mobility, ensuring that users can transport the machines effortlessly across various terrains.

A significant feature of both the E 130.1 and E 140.1 models is their automatic start-stop function. This technology enhances energy efficiency by automatically shutting down the motor when the trigger is not engaged, thereby extending the machine's lifespan and reducing electricity consumption.
